Transaction 43263e0bec6f7c7f417887f83089ba76c27581c7b072a520ee6821463d958432
1 Input
1 Output
-
43263e0bec6f7c7f417887f83089ba76c27581c7b072a520ee6821463d958432:0
- value
- 109521
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 484436070431593a2fe21a8042bb66a40b338d0c OP_EQUAL
- address
- 38H8HjzNAMCpL35dDzqCtifsMsPc9z8VVN